Congratulations to class of 2012 award winners!

Nicholas Bodurian, Patrick Hipple, Stacey Hochkins, Caroline Knuff, Andrew Kraynak and Paul Maloney, the 2012 Economics Department honors students.  Link to papers and photos

Nicholas Bodurian '12, winner of the 2011-2012 John J. Cummings, Jr./BAI Award, given annually to the best paper in finance, for his paper "Bailouts and Bank Risk: The Association between Bank Specific Risk Measurements and TARP Participation."

Colby Carter '12, winner of the Freeman M. Saltus Prize, given annually for the best essay in economics, for his paper "Government Spending: Is Divided Government Effectively Small Government?"

Kelly Garvey '12, winner of the Economics and Accounting Achievement Award, given to the senior student who has contributed most significantly to the department in terms of scholarship, service, and/or enthusiasm.

Kerry O. Wright '12, winner of the Boston Chapter of Financial Executives International "Outstanding Senior Award".

The Holy Cross team consisting of Jules Biolsi, Lauren McCarthy and Casandra Medeiros had an excellent showing at the Intercollegiate Business Ethics Case Competition.  They presented their case "Coca Cola's Deceptive Marketing Tactics." The team made it to the final round of the case competition and Jules was champion of the 90 second ethics challenge.

Economics Major Applications

Students can apply for the major after they have completed an economics course at Holy Cross. Applications will be solicited in September 2011 and January 2012.  In September, the application period begins on Monday, September 19, and the applications are due on Tuesday, September 27 at noon.  In January, the application period begins on Wednesday, January 25, and the applications are due on Tuesday, January 31 at noon.  All applications are submitted online via the Moodle site. A reminder and instructions for accessing the site will be sent via email at the beginning of the semester. Here is a sample application form (.pdf).

Economics-Accounting Major Applications

Applications will be solicited in October 2011 and Spring 2012.  In October, the applications are due on Friday, October 7 at noon.  All members of the class 2014 and 2015 that are currently enrolled in or have completed ECOA 181 Financial Accounting will be eligible to apply.  All applications are submitted online via the Moodle site. A reminder and instructions for accessing the site will be sent via email at the beginning of the end of September. A sample application form (.pdf) is provided.
